Facets packages have a weird structure IMO. I think that we should organize the
packages by feature, and not by functionality (index/search). For example:
* o.a.l.facet.index -- core facets indexing
* o.a.l.facet.search -- core facets search
* o.a.l.facet.params -- all facets params (indexing and search)
* o.a.l.facet.associations -- all associations code (we can break to
sub-index/search packages if needed)
* o.a.l.facet.partitions -- all partitions related code
* o.a.l.facet.sampling -- all sampling related code
* o.a.l.facet.util -- consolidate all utils under that, even those that are
currently under o.a.l.util
* o.a.l.facet.encoding -- move all encoders under it (from o.a.l.util)
* o.a.l.facet.taxonomy -- all taxonomy related stuff.
The motivation -- if I want to handle all associations related code, it should
be very easy to locate it.
